Is it possible to read timecode written in audio track (Premiere Pro CC 2018)?

New Here ,
Dec 08, 2017 Dec 08, 2017

Hello,

On one project we use cameras and recordes, which can´t use timecode itself, so we wrote timecode track using external device to left/ or right channel of audiotracks.

So after shooting I got some audio and video tracks, where in left channel is normal audio and in the other channel should be some timecode information (which sounds like "bzzzz"), is there any way, without using external programs, how to read the timecode information from this audio noise track and somehow set it to the whole file?
